Abstract of the course
Viscoelastic fluids are ubiquitous in technological applications since this class of materials includes most aggregates of long polymeric molecules, possibly in solution with simpler fluids.
The main challenge for their mathematical modelling come from the transient and deformation-dependent elastic response that is observed in several experiments.
In these lectures, we will first review the standard measurements used to characterize viscoelastic fluids and then discuss classical and more recent continuum mechanical models for these materials.
Finally, some issues related to the mathematical analysis of the associated differential equations will be introduced.
